Job summary

Ryanair Engineering is expanding its maintenance capacity across Europe with a Base Maintenance Manager (Lead) role. The successful candidate will oversee base maintenance performance across six sites, including Shannon, and manage multi-site operations in a fast-paced environment.

The role requires significant Part-145 base maintenance experience, strong leadership, and the ability to travel across bases while ensuring safety, compliance, and high workmanship standards.

Qualifications

  • Significant experience in base/heavy maintenance within a Part-145 environment.
  • Proven leadership experience managing multi-site or distributed teams.
  • Strong understanding of EASA Part-145 and MOE requirements.
  • Track record of delivering operational performance in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ong leadership, organisational, and communication skills.
  • Flexible approach with the ability to travel frequently across bases.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and manage all Base Maintenance Managers across the network, driving performance and accountability across each location.
  • Ensure all maintenance is delivered and certified in accordance with MOE and Part-145 requirements.
  • Maintain the highest standards of safety, compliance, and workmanship across all bases.
  • Oversee manpower planning, resource allocation, and production delivery across multiple sites.
  • Ensure all bases are appropriately resourced with facilities, tooling, materials, and competent personnel.
  • Drive training, competency, and performance standards across all maintenance teams.
  • Manage subcontractor performance and ensure compliance with contractual and quality requirements.
  • Liaise with CAMO representatives, suppliers, and internal stakeholders on maintenance planning and defect resolution.
  • Own safety performance, including risk management, occurrence reporting, and human factors.
  • Investigate and resolve operational, safety, and compliance issues across the network.
  • Ensure MOE and technical procedures are applied consistently and kept up to date.
  • Provide regular reporting and escalation to the Head of Heavy Maintenance.
